How to Choose the Best Pregnancy Pillow for Your Needs

Picking the right pregnancy pillow comes down to your sleep habits, specific pain points, bed size, and personal preferences. With so many shapes, fills, and features available, here is a breakdown to help you make the right call.

Pillow Shapes and What They Do Best

U-shaped pillows wrap around your entire body, providing support on both sides simultaneously. They are the best choice if you toss and turn at night because you stay supported regardless of which side you face. The trade-off is that they take up the most bed space and can crowd a partner.

C-shaped pillows support one side of your body in a curved shape, offering back and belly support while leaving the other side open. They are less bulky than U-shaped options and work well for consistent side sleepers who rarely flip sides during the night.

J-shaped pillows are similar to C-shaped but with a more open curve, giving you flexibility in positioning. They are great for targeted back and belly support and often feel less confining than full wraparound designs.

F-shaped pillows combine a body pillow with an adjustable wedge, giving you back and belly support in a space-saving form. They are ideal for women who share a bed and want support without crowding their partner.

Wedge pillows are compact, portable, and versatile. They work best for targeted support like belly lift or back cushioning rather than full-body wrapping. Many women use wedges alongside their regular sleeping pillow for a minimalist setup.

Fill Materials and Comfort Levels

Polyester fiber fill is the most common and affordable option. It provides soft to medium support, is lightweight, and easy to reposition. The downside is that polyester can compress over time and may need refluffing. Shredded memory foam, like in the Snuggle-Pedic, offers superior contouring and pressure relief but adds significant weight. Solid memory foam, as in the Hiccapop wedge, provides firm, consistent support in a compact form.

For cooling properties, look for bamboo-derived viscose covers (QUEEN ROSE, Meiz) or jersey cotton (INSEN, Momcozy J-shaped). These materials breathe significantly better than velvet or fleece, which is important since pregnancy raises your core body temperature. Size and Height Considerations

Standard pregnancy pillows range from 55 to 58 inches, which works well for women up to about 5 foot 8. If you are taller, look for extended options like the AMCATON 60-inch or the QUEEN ROSE 65-inch model. If you are petite or have a smaller bed, compact options like the Momcozy J-shaped at 40 inches or the Hiccapop wedge at 15 inches make more sense. The Momcozy Dreamlign U Pro with its adjustable 50 to 72-inch range is worth considering if your height falls outside standard ranges.

When to Start Using a Pregnancy Pillow

Most women start feeling the need for additional sleep support around 16 to 20 weeks as the belly begins to show and sleeping on the back becomes uncomfortable. Doctors recommend side sleeping from the second trimester onward to optimize blood flow to the baby, and a pregnancy pillow helps you maintain that position comfortably. There is no harm in starting earlier if you are already experiencing discomfort or if you are a natural back or stomach sleeper who wants to adjust before the habit becomes harder to break.

Is F shape or U shape pillow better for pregnancy?

U-shaped pillows provide dual-sided support, keeping you comfortable regardless of which side you sleep on. They are best for restless sleepers who change positions at night. F-shaped pillows offer one-sided support with an adjustable belly wedge, saving significant bed space. Choose a U-shape if you toss and turn or want full-body cocoon support. Choose an F-shape if you share a bed, sleep consistently on one side, or prefer using your own head pillow.

Do pregnancy pillows help with scoliosis?

Pregnancy pillows can provide symptomatic relief for scoliosis discomfort during pregnancy by supporting proper spinal alignment and reducing pressure on the curved areas of the spine. The U-shaped and C-shaped designs are most helpful because they support multiple points along the body simultaneously. However, pregnancy pillows are not a medical treatment for scoliosis. Women with scoliosis should consult their healthcare provider for a comprehensive pain management plan during pregnancy.
